1、熟练运用jQuery、JavaScript、Ajax等脚本技术。能熟悉运用validate等jQuery插件。
2、熟悉spring、springmvc、springboot、springcloud、mybatis、等开源框架。
3、熟悉Java基础,面向对象程序设计思想,具备独立开发能力。
4、熟悉MVC开发模式,具备良好的编程习惯。
5、熟悉spring的aop、ioc、di设计思想。
6、熟悉MySQL关系型数据库,Redis持久化和缓存同步
7、熟悉Linux基本命令,利用xshell操作linux系统,xftp上传下载等操作。
8、熟悉maven项目管理工具,和项目管理系统的使用。
9、熟悉接口测试工具postman,redis可视化工具redisDesktopManager。
10、熟悉Nginx服务器,以及Nginx文件服务器代理配置。
11、熟悉使用docker部署项目与jekins自动化部署工具
12、熟悉rabbitmq等消息中间件的使用。
1.参与数据库的设计
2.完成通讯录、帮助模块代码编写
3.完成附件服务的部署与文档编写
4.完成所负责模块的数据库设计、概要设计、详细设计文档编写
5.帮助其它模块代码编写
6.对项目进行局部测试